Quinndale, Hamilton is a west GTA neighbourhood notable for its singles, renters, business and health professionals and tradespeople. It has a higher than average population of immigrants, particularly those from the Philippines. Residents tend to be younger with a significant number of babies, kids aged 5 to 14, youth aged 15 to 24 and adults aged 30 to 44.
